naiksrinu / UAV_DataSet_NetworkCommunicationLinks
UAV Network Communication Experimental dataset is a collection of network traffic captured from a wireless network used by unmanned aerial vehicles (UAVs) during a simulated search and rescue mission. The dataset includes both legitimate network traffic and traffic generated by WiFi and GPS attacks.
